IMF: Greece will need far bigger debt relief that was considered by the Eurozone governments

Reuters reported on Tuesday that Greece will need far bigger debt relief that was considered by the Eurozone governments, according to a confidential study by the International Monetary Fund (IMF).

"The dramatic deterioration in debt sustainability points to the need for debt relief on a scale that would need to go well beyond what has been under consideration to date - and what has been proposed by the European Stability Mechanism (ESM)," the IMF said.

A senior IMF official said on Tuesday that the debt relief would give Greece's economy a chance to recover.
